The head priest of Bageshwar Dham, Pandit Dhirendra Krishna Shashtri is very famous for his funny nature and on-point predictions. His videos make rounds on the internet and netizens love his tape. A video of Pandit Dhirendra Krishna Shashtri, the head of Madhya Pradesh’s famous Bageshwar Dham, is popular on social media. It’s unclear where this video is from, but based on the question-and-answer format, it appears to be from Bihar. A young man’s application is accepted in this case. He is summoned to the stage by Pandit Dhirendra. They are conversing with each other.

Bageshwar Dham head priest Dhirendra Shashtri predicts job

During this time, Pandit Dhirendra Krishna Shastri informs the young guy that he may be able to find work on December 8, 2024. This young man has completed his BEd and wishes to pursue a career in education. He compliments Pandit Dhirendra after reading his paper. This incident has gone viral on social media, with many claiming that job opportunities for BEd people will be made on December 8th, 2024.

In the video, Bageshwar Dham head priest Pandit Dhirendra Krishna Shastri says to the young guy, “The work is done, he wants a job, there will be progress, and he has only one application in court for a job. By the end of 2024, yoga will work in your favour. Begin planning for it right now.’ The person then inquires which department the position is located in, Guruji. According to Pandit Dhirendra, the potential of December 8th is being developed.
